Dedham Civic Pride's Collection of Painted Flowerpots Grows
Two newly painted planters where placed at the entrance to Oakdale Square's Veterans Park
Recently Dedham Civic Pride commissioned local artist Cindy Prevett to paint to planter in a patriotic theme since the planters would sit at the entrance of Veterans Park in Oakdale Square. The red and white pots with an eagle profile were recently planted with fall chrysanthemums and will greet visitors to the park through the end of October.
Dedham Civic Pride, along with planting and maintaining green space, has sponsored several public art projects in recent years. About three years ago, Civic Pride did a painted utility box project, where three utility boxes were decorated with original artwork by local artists. Cindy did one of the utility boxes in the project which is located at the corner of Sawmill Lane and Milton Street; the box is covered with butterflies in bright lively colors. Cindy also did the painted piano in Dedham Square which was a project of the Dedham School of Music.
Along with the two eagle themed pots, Cindy designed and painted the two ladybug pots that are at the entrance to the Main Library on Church Street. Civic Pride will be commissioning Cindy to do two more planters that will sit in front of Barnes Memorial next spring.
